Samsung spills small details regarding the Galaxy S 4G for T-Mobile
Share:
Granted that it's officially confirmed from Samsung's side, there are still slim details about the handset itself – such as actual hardware specifications. However, we do know that it'll be flaunting that all too distinguishable Super AMOLED display, but no specific size was given. Moreover, it'll be running Android 2.2 Froyo from the onset and will be the first Samsung branded device on T-Mobile's lineup to brandish 21Mbps HSPA+ download speeds.
Aside from those few pieces of information, everything else is pretty much in the dark – but it's clearly shaping up to be a better, stronger, and faster Samsung Vibrant.
